Bilobed Placenta with Velamentous Cord Insertion
Bilobed Placenta - placenta with two equal-sized lobes connected by a thin bridge.
Velamentous Cord Insertion - (velamentous insertion) Clinical term for describing a placental abnormality where the placental cord inserts into the chorion laeve (placental membranes) away from the edge of the placenta.
